Go ahead and count with pen and paper. You'll end up with the same information as bukboy has already shared. Theory comes AFTER the fact. You don't make music based on it. You can completely deny following the guidelines for as long as you want but until you start paying attention, and you know them well, you won't be able to break them appropriately. |

There are no rules.
People say you musn't use half step patterns... bull
I've heard drum and bass which flipped forwards by half a beat every ??? (32) barss in a patternised way and was just so trippy. Yes, it threw people, but yes, people got into it and actively enjoyed being thrown. Familiarity breeds contempt!
As long as there is a pattern people will dig it, and get off on it. IME.
